WHEREAS, The Pennsylvania Intergovernmental Cooperation Authority (PICA) has approved the City's Five Year Financial Plan for the City of Philadelphia covering Fiscal Years 2005 through 2009 (Plan) on July 7, 2004; and
WHEREAS, The City now wishes to submit to PICA certain revisions to the Plan; and
WHEREAS, The revisions are contemplated by Sections 4.08(b), 5.07(b) and 5.08(e) of the January 8, 1992, Intergovernmental Cooperation Agreement between the City and PICA; and
WHEREAS, The implementation of certain of the revisions will require the adoption of an Ordinance or Ordinances of City Council; and
WHEREAS, Council wishes to provide its approval of such proposed revisions to the Plan; now therefore
RESOLVED, B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PHILADELPHIA, That Council hereby approves the revisions to the Five-Year Financial Plan for Fiscal Year 2005 through Fiscal Year 2009, as reflected in the attached Exhibit A. The Chief Clerk shall keep on file and make available for public inspection a copy of said Exhibit A.
